What a find! This is without question the best Spanish restaurant in Westchester County, and as good as anything similar in the city. The service is friendly and professional. Lots of small plates to share: most are large enough for a group of 4. Wonderful entrees, too, with lots of seafood options. The seafood Paella for 2 could easily serve 3 or 4, and the house salad was large enough for 3 or 4. We stated with the fired artichokes and the anchovies. Absolutely the best anchovy prep I've had this side of Spain. No reservations, but they manage to get you seated as soon as they can, and you can eat at the bar. Simply outstanding.
The attentive staff will care and serve your party with discreet efficiency.
The sangria is delicious and each glass or pitcher is mixed to order. We decided the red is our favorite. The pitcher will yield at least 4 good size glasses and is a better value.
The Tapas dishes are top notch but take note they are bigger than you might expect compared to other Tapas spots. They are closer to appetizer size and priced that way. Order accordingly.
The Garlic Shrimp was absolutely perfect. The Tortills Espanola is a creamy and delicious homerun.
Our entree was the Carne Paella featuring 2 cuts of beef, chicken, chorizo and a mushroom sofrito.
Presented in an authentic Paella pan at your table. Available and priced as dinner for 2, 4, 6 or 8.
The meats melted in our mouths and the rice cooked to perfection. This is a huge portion of food and worth every penny. Dessert we shared was Orange Flan and we wished we had ordered two.
